E-Business Support Programme 2018-2020
Notice Description
The Council is inviting tenders for the delivery of a second e-Business Support Programme. The programme will offer a package of flexible and responsive support aimed at improving the knowledge, skills and application of digital business tools by businesses based in the Royal Borough. The contract will run for a period of three years, starting from January 2018. Additional information: It is anticipated that the programme will run from January 2018 and support a minimum of 400 Royal Greenwich based businesses over three years. The programme is intended to benefit trading SMEs and is not a start-up programme. It is aimed at SMEs who have a trading history or have already started trading from all areas of the Borough. The emphasis is on business support; this is not intended to be solely a training programme although training will clearly feature. There will need to be a balance of one to one and group activities that ensures the service is responsive to the needs of individual businesses drawn from a diverse base in terms of sector, size, experience and technical knowledge. The programme should deliver a package of flexible and responsive support that will help businesses identify and build or expand their on-line presence and increase use of digital media and tools. This should include provision of one to one business support including help to develop bespoke digital business plans and follow up support to ensure implementation and application of knowledge/ skills gained. The programme will need to offer a menu of support to develop skills and knowledge of digital technology and applications in the following key areas: * E-Commerce; digital business tools (CRM systems, accounting etc) * On line marketing and trading (taking orders and payment on-line and stock control) * International trading on line * Social media for business (individual businesses and groups of businesses where this supports supply chain development) * Establishing a strong on line presence (website design/creation) * E-tendering and crowd funding * Cyber security and data protection NB This list is not exhaustive; other areas will be added in response to business needs and changing technology. The service should include support to encourage groups of businesses to grow their on line presence and marketing where this helps to promote specific locations (e.g. shopping area) product group (e.g. food, crafts) or events (e.g. markets, Tall Ships etc). Support to help grow supply chains should also feature in the programme. Success measures will include improved SME skills and knowledge; improved SME business performance (e.g. increased sales/turn-over,) jobs safeguarded/ created and an increase in local supply chain activity/ multiplier effect. All KPIs will need to be evidenced through transparent and auditable records and independent evaluation.
